22092x0xry_cms 2025-2026 nc math 2 credit recovery\ncomplex numbers and square roots\nif the discriminant of a quadratic equation is 4, which statement describes the roots?\nthere is one complex root.\nthere are two complex roots.\nthere is one real root.\nthere are two real roots.

Answer

Explanation:

Step1: Recall discriminant rules

For quadratic $ax^2+bx+c=0$, discriminant $\Delta = b^2-4ac$:

  • $\Delta > 0$: Two distinct real roots
  • $\Delta = 0$: One real repeated root
  • $\Delta < 0$: Two complex conjugate roots

Step2: Evaluate given discriminant

Given $\Delta = 4$, which is $\Delta > 0$.

Answer:

There are two real roots.
